The GP15500EFI and GP18000EFI electric start portable generators
are the most powerful generators on the market at an exceptional
value. These generators are powerful enough to start multiple 5-ton
air conditioning units and can provide power for up to 16 circuits.
The generators are assembled in the USA using domestic and foreign
parts.

Product Usage Instructions:

Step 1:

Choose which devices you want to power at the same time.

Step 2:

Record and add the running watts listed for each device that you
need to power.

Step 3:

Record the starting watts listed for each device.

Step 4:

Select the one device with the highest starting watts. Add that
number to the total running watts to determine the total wattage
requirement.

Note:

Watts listed are approximate. Check your appliance for actual
requirements. Total wattage requirements assume intermittent
starting of devices.
